Area contextNeighborhood Overview – BIG 20 Bowling Center (Scarborough, ME)
BIG 20 Bowling Center is conveniently situated in Scarborough, Maine, along U.S. Route 1, a primary thoroughfare known for its mix of retail, dining, and recreational options. The location offers straightforward access for local residents and visitors alike, benefiting from its position within the Greater Portland metropolitan area. Major highways like I-95 and I-295 are a short drive away, connecting Scarborough to Portland and other New England cities. Public transportation options are somewhat limited directly to the bowling center, making personal vehicles or rideshares the most common modes of transport. Parking is ample and generally easy to navigate, with dedicated lots designed to accommodate peak hours. For those arriving from further afield, Portland International Jetport (PWM) is the nearest airport, approximately a 15-20 minute drive depending on traffic. Smart arrival tactics often involve aiming for off-peak hours if possible, or arriving a few minutes before your reservation or planned start time to account for any check-in procedures or lane assignments, especially on weekends or during local school breaks.

As Maine's oldest lighthouse, Portland Head Light in Cape Elizabeth is a picturesque landmark offering breathtaking ocean views and a glimpse into maritime history. Situated within Fort Williams Park, the grounds are perfect for walking, picnicking, and exploring the rocky coastline. The adjacent museum details the lighthouse’s history and the keepers who served there. It’s a must-visit for scenic beauty, photography opportunities, and a sense of coastal Maine charm. Allow ample time to wander the park grounds and enjoy the dramatic Atlantic vistas, especially at sunset.

Weather & Seasons at BIG 20 Bowling Center
- Winter: Winter in Scarborough is cold, with average temperatures often below freezing. Snowfall is common, blanketing the region and creating a picturesque, albeit sometimes challenging, winter landscape. Visitors should pack heavy coats, thermal layers, hats, gloves, and waterproof boots for any outdoor excursions. Indoor activities like bowling at BIG 20 are popular during these months, providing a warm escape. Travel might be affected by snow, so check road conditions before heading out.
- Spring & early summer: Spring brings milder temperatures to Scarborough, though it can remain cool, especially in early April. Expect a mix of sunny days and rainy periods, with average temperatures gradually climbing. Layers are key for dressing, with light jackets or sweaters being practical. As early summer approaches, temperatures become warmer and more consistent, making outdoor activities increasingly enjoyable. It’s a good time for exploring parks and coastal areas as they become fully accessible.
- Mid-summer: Mid-summer in Scarborough is typically warm to hot, with July and August offering the most consistently pleasant weather for outdoor fun. High temperatures are common, making it ideal for water parks, beach visits, and enjoying the local attractions. Lightweight clothing, sun protection, and staying hydrated are essential. Evenings can offer a slight cooling breeze, but generally, summer attire is appropriate for most daytime activities.
- Fall season: Fall brings a refreshing coolness to Scarborough as temperatures begin to drop, usually starting in September and becoming quite crisp by October. The region is known for its stunning autumn foliage, making scenic drives and park visits particularly appealing. Visitors should pack sweaters, light jackets, and comfortable walking shoes for exploring. While outdoor activities are pleasant, be prepared for cooler evenings and variable weather as the season progresses towards winter.
- Rain & snow: Scarborough experiences rain throughout the year, with heavier periods often occurring in spring and fall. Snow is prevalent during winter months, often necessitating adjustments to travel plans. Visitors should always pack an umbrella or raincoat for rainy days and waterproof, insulated gear for snowy conditions. Indoor venues like BIG 20 Bowling Center, shopping malls, and cinemas provide excellent options for entertainment regardless of the weather outside.
